Add to basketPrint on Demand. This book is an extensive treatise on cataract extraction - a surgical procedure for removing clouded lenses from the eye. It's a comprehensive guide for ophthalmic surgeons, detailing the history and evolution of the procedure, the tools used, and relevant scientific principles. The author draws on decades of experience and a vast number of performed extractions to elucidate the complexities of the operation. Covering common and complicated cataracts and their operative management, the book also provides insight into the potential complications that may arise and how to prevent them. Ultimately, the book serves as a valuable resource for surgeons looking to enhance their cataract extraction techniques and improve patient outcomes. Mastering cataract extraction: practical techniques and the reasoning behind them.
This classic surgical reference explains how ophthalmic surgeons approach removal of the cloudy lens, with focus on reducing pain, improving safety, and minimizing complications.
Drawing on detailed operative descriptions and instrument use, it covers key methods for opening the capsule, removing cortex, and delivering the lens. It discusses the hands-on steps, the choice between upward and downward corneal sections, and the ways to manage the wound to prevent infection and loss of intraocular contents. The text also describes variations in technique, including conjunctival flaps and cone-shaped or external approaches, along with the considerations that guide each choice.
